在區(qū)塊鏈領域,密碼學算法的選擇是決定項目安全基石與性能表現(xiàn)的核心環(huán)節(jié),橢圓曲線密碼學(ECC)因其較高的安全強度和較短的密鑰長度,在公鑰加密、數(shù)字簽名等場景中得到了廣泛應用,YB幣在設計之初,對其所采用的橢圓曲線進行了審慎評估與選擇,其依據(jù)主要圍繞安全性、性能效率、生態(tài)兼容性及未來發(fā)展趨勢等多個維度綜合考量,旨在構建一個既安全高效又具備良好擴展性的底層架構。

核心考量:安全性優(yōu)先

橢圓曲線的安全性依賴于橢圓曲線離散對數(shù)問題(ECDLP)的難解性,YB幣在選擇橢圓曲線時,將安全性置于首位,主要基于以下幾點:

  1. 抗量子計算威脅的潛力(雖然非首要,但長遠考慮):盡管目前廣泛使用的 secp256k1 和 NIST P-256 等曲線在經(jīng)典計算機下被認為是安全的,但它們面臨量子計算的潛在威脅(Shor算法可在多項式時間內(nèi)解決ECDLP),YB幣在選擇時,可能會評估曲線是否具備一定的“抗量子計算”潛力,或者至少選擇在未來一段時間內(nèi),即使量子計算取得突破,仍能提供足夠安全裕度的曲線,一些基于格理論或新型假設的曲線可能被納入考量,但更可能是在現(xiàn)有成熟曲線中選擇被認為量子抗性相對更強的,或者為未來升級預留空間。

  2. 曲線的數(shù)學性質(zhì)與攻擊歷史

    • 避免特殊結構曲線:選擇那些沒有已知特殊數(shù)學結構、能夠抵抗已知的特殊攻擊方法(如MOV攻擊、Weil攻擊、Anomalous攻擊等)的橢圓曲線,這些攻擊方法如果適用于特定曲線,可能會將ECDLP的難度降低到可接受的范圍以下。
    • 成熟的審查與社區(qū)驗證:傾向于選擇經(jīng)過全球密碼學界長期、廣泛審查和驗證的曲線,secp256k1 比特幣采用的曲線,因其經(jīng)過比特幣網(wǎng)絡多年的實際運行考驗,其安全性得到了高度認可,NIST P-256 等標準曲線也經(jīng)過了嚴格的標準制定流程和學術界的審查。
  3. 密鑰長度與安全強度匹配:YB幣會根據(jù)其預期的安全級別要求,選擇能夠提供足夠安全強度的曲線,256位的橢圓曲線(如secp256k1, P-256)被認為提供了約128位的對稱安全強度,這對于大多數(shù)區(qū)塊鏈應用場景來說是足夠且安全的。

性能與效率的權衡

在保證安全的前提下,性能效率是YB幣選擇橢圓曲線的另一關鍵依據(jù),這主要涉及:

  1. 計算復雜度與簽名/驗證速度:不同的橢圓曲線,其點乘、點加等基本運算的計算復雜度不同,這直接影響到數(shù)字簽名生成(如ECDSA)和驗證的速度,YB幣會選擇那些在目標硬件平臺(如節(jié)點服務器、輕量級錢包)上能夠實現(xiàn)較快簽名和驗證速度的曲線,以提升交易處理效率,降低節(jié)點運行成本。

  2. 密鑰與簽名長度:ECC的優(yōu)勢之一是在相同安全強度下,密鑰和簽名的長度顯著小于RSA等傳統(tǒng)算法,較短的密鑰和簽名意味著更小的存儲空間、更低的帶寬占用和更快的網(wǎng)絡傳輸速度,這對于區(qū)塊鏈網(wǎng)絡的擴展性和用戶體驗(如錢包同步、交易廣播)都至關重要。

  3. 實現(xiàn)難度與優(yōu)化空間:選擇那些有成熟實現(xiàn)方案、易于優(yōu)化且在不同編程語言和平臺上都能高效部署的曲線,有助于YB幣技術團隊快速開發(fā)和維護,并確保在不同設備上的性能表現(xiàn)。

生態(tài)兼容性與標準化

  1. 社區(qū)共識與主流采用:選擇與主流區(qū)塊鏈項目(如比特幣、以太坊等)兼容或相似的橢圓曲線,有助于降低開發(fā)者的學習成本,促進工具、錢包、交易所等基礎設施的復用,從而加速YB幣生態(tài)的構建,如果YB幣選擇secp256k1,那么現(xiàn)有的比特幣錢包庫和工具可以更容易地適配或復用。

  2. 標準化與合規(guī)性:遵循國際或國家標準的橢圓曲線(如NIST FIPS 186-4標準中的曲線,SECG推薦的曲線)更容易獲得監(jiān)管機構和傳統(tǒng)行業(yè)的認可,為YB幣的未來合規(guī)發(fā)展和廣泛應用掃清障礙。

未來發(fā)展趨勢與可擴展性

  1. 曲線的長期生命力:YB幣在選擇時也會考慮曲線的生命周期,避免選擇那些可能在未來因新的數(shù)學發(fā)現(xiàn)或計算能力提升而被快速破解的曲線,選擇那些有持續(xù)研究支持、社區(qū)活躍、長期維護的曲線。

  2. 平滑升級路徑:雖然曲線選擇通常在項目初期確定,但YB幣可能會考慮在密碼學算法出現(xiàn)重大革新時,是否具備平滑升級或分叉采用新曲線的可能性,以應對未來的安全挑戰(zhàn)。

YB幣對橢圓曲線的選擇,并非單一維度的決策,而是一個在安全性、性能、生態(tài)兼容性及未來前景之間尋求最佳平衡點的綜合過程,其核心目標是選擇一條能夠為YB幣網(wǎng)絡提供堅實安全保障、高效運行性能、良好生態(tài)基礎,并具備長期發(fā)展?jié)摿Φ臋E圓曲線,這種審慎而周全的選擇依據(jù),體現(xiàn)了YB幣項目在技術底層設計上的嚴謹與遠見,為其成為安全、可靠、高效的區(qū)塊

隨機配圖
鏈價值網(wǎng)絡奠定了重要的密碼學基礎,具體選擇了哪條曲線(如secp256k1, P-256, Curve25519等),則需要結合YB幣項目的具體白皮書和技術文檔才能最終確定,但上述的考量維度無疑是其決策過程中的核心準則。